What does the wideband say as you are driving/tuning it? Post a log to go along with the tun file you posted. Not sure what your specific question is. Do you understand hp tuners software? If so efi live is pretty much the same. Also why not run a 2002 1221156 operating system. Good support for that one with a cos.

slows10
August 30th, 2012, 12:13 PM
If you are running no maf, then you need to fail the maf and tune it sd. You can run a cos with 2 bar fueling.

joecar
August 30th, 2012, 12:26 PM
The COS's have tables for boost (which will make tuning easier)...
